THK’s LM Stroke Model ST ST SERIES represents a sophisticated advancement in linear motion technology, engineered to deliver exceptional precision, reliability, and efficiency in demanding industrial applications. This series features a compact, integrated design that combines a linear motion guide with a built-in stroke mechanism, eliminating the need for external components and simplifying installation. Key technical specifications include high load capacities, with dynamic load ratings up to 7.35 kN and static load ratings reaching 14.7 kN, ensuring robust performance under heavy operational stresses. The system incorporates precision-ground raceways and high-grade steel balls, which minimize friction and provide smooth, consistent motion with positional accuracy within microns. Additionally, the ST SERIES is designed with a sealed structure to prevent contamination from dust, debris, or moisture, making it suitable for harsh environments. Options for lubrication systems, such as grease fittings or automatic lubricators, further enhance longevity and reduce maintenance intervals.
